Abstract
Alumni is a product of an educational institution. The quality of the alumni shows the quality of the educational institution. The fact is increasingly felt, especially for college alumni. This is because alumni of college will directly come into contact with the world of work. Tracer study activity is one of the activities that have a very strategic value in the development of a college. STMIK Akakom is one of the universities in the city of Yogyakarta is required to always mempebaiki quality of education process accompanied by efforts to increase its relevance in the framework of global competition. In addition Tracer study is one effort that is expected to provide information to evaluate educational outcomes in STMIK Akakom. This information is used for further development in ensuring educational quality. This research produces alumni application of STMIK Akakom alumni by utilizing Geographic information system to map the location where alumni work, besides that it also displays alumni data in the form of year of admission, graduation year, long waiting time to work first after graduation
